Where Birds Don't Fly
"Real Monsters don't live under beds."
Originally released in 2017. Where Birds Don't Fly is a crime/drama film. directed by Alek Gearhart. With a runtime of 2h 1m, it's an epic theatrical experience.
Starring Lamar Bell, Dylan Hobbs, and Bailey Estevan
Synopsis
A team of hardened detectives come face to face with evil as they investigate a killing spree in San Bernardino California.
